Suzanne Livingston is the curator of the Barbican Centre’s new exhibition “AI: More Than Human” which explores our relationship with Artificial Intelligence. In our conversation, we discuss the 90's fascination with cybernetic culture, AI's origins in the Middle Ages and its Golden Age in the 19th and 20th centuries. We also try to expand our thinking on the burning philosophical question of what it means to be human.
